How are emergency calls handled in Webex Calling?

Explanation:
The handling of emergency calls in Webex Calling is primarily focused on ensuring that emergency services can quickly and accurately respond to calls. The correct option highlights that emergency calls are routed with enhanced location information for emergency services. This feature is crucial because when a user dials an emergency number, providing precise location data allows emergency responders to determine the caller's location without delay. This capability enhances the overall safety and reliability of emergency response, as first responders can arrive at the necessary location promptly and effectively.
